无论是程序员在开发过程中需要上传代码到服务器,还是运维人员需要远程管理服务器上的文件,高效、安全、便捷的文件传输工具都是必不可少的
然而,在使用Xshell进行文件上传时,有时会收到提示建议下载并使用Xftp,这一提示背后隐藏着怎样的逻辑与优势呢?本文将深入探讨Xshell与Xftp的协同作用,以及为何在面对文件传输需求时,选择Xftp是一个明智且高效的选择
一、Xshell与Xftp的简介及关联 Xshell是一款功能强大的终端仿真软件,它提供了对SSH、SFTP、TELNET等多种协议的全面支持,使用户能够轻松访问和管理远程服务器
其界面简洁、操作便捷,是众多开发者和运维人员的首选工具
而Xftp,作为NetSarang公司开发的另一款明星产品,则专注于文件传输领域,支持FTP、SFTP等多种文件传输协议,为用户提供了高速、稳定的文件上传下载服务
虽然Xshell本身也具备一定的文件传输能力,但在处理大量文件或大型文件时,其传输效率和稳定性可能无法完全满足专业需求
此时,Xshell会智能地提示用户下载并使用Xftp,以获得更佳的文件传输体验
这种提示不仅是对用户需求的精准把握,更是对Xftp专业能力的充分信任
二、Xftp相较于Xshell内置传输功能的优势 2.1 更高的传输效率 Xftp针对文件传输进行了深度优化,其传输速度相较于Xshell内置的SFTP等功能有着显著的提升
特别是在处理大型文件或大量文件时,Xftp能够充分利用网络带宽,实现高速的文件传输
这对于需要频繁上传下载大型项目文件或数据库备份的用户来说,无疑是一个巨大的福音
2.2 更强的稳定性 文件传输过程中,稳定性是至关重要的
Xftp通过采用先进的传输协议和错误处理机制,确保了文件传输的完整性和准确性
即使在遇到网络波动或传输中断的情况下,Xftp也能够自动恢复传输,大大减少了因传输失败而带来的时间和资源浪费
2.3 更丰富的功能 相较于Xshell内置的传输功能,Xftp提供了更为丰富的文件管理功能
用户不仅可以进行简单的上传下载操作,还可以进行文件删除、重命名、权限修改等高级操作
此外,Xftp还支持断点续传、文件筛选、批量操作等实用功能,进一步提升了用户的操作效率和便利性
2.4 更安全的数据传输 在数据安全日益受到重视的今天,Xftp通过支持SFTP等安全传输协议,为用户提供了加密的文件传输通道
这有效防止了数据在传输过程中被窃取或篡改的风险,保障了用户数据的安全性和隐私性
三、Xshell与Xftp的协同工作流程 在实际应用中,Xshell与Xftp往往协同工作,共同完成远程服务器的管理和文件传输任务
用户可以先使用Xshell登录到远程服务器,进行必要的命令操作和配置更改
当需要上传或下载文件时,再切换到Xftp界面,利用Xftp的高效传输能力和丰富功能来完成文件传输任务
这种协同工作流程不仅提高了工作效率,还确保了操作的连贯性和准确性
四、用户案例分享 为了更好地说明Xshell与Xftp的协同优势,以下分享几个实际用户案例: 案例一:程序员小李 小李是一名程序员,经常需要将开发完成的代码上传到服务器进行测试
在使用Xshell进行代码上传时,他遇到了传输速度慢和偶尔传输失败的问题
后来,他听从了Xshell的提示下载了Xftp,并尝试使用Xftp进行代码上传
结果,他发现Xftp的传输速度明显更快,而且即使在网络不稳定的情况下也能保证传输的成功率
从此,小李便成为了Xftp的忠实用户
案例二:运维小张 小张是一名运维人员,需要定期备份服务器上的数据库文件
由于数据库文件通常都很大,他之前使用Xshell内置的SFTP功能进行备份时总是需要花费很长时间
后来,他尝试使用Xftp进行备份操作,发现备份速度有了显著的提升
此外,Xftp还支持断点续传功能,即使因为某些原因中断了备份操作,他也能够轻松地从断点处继续备份,大大提高了工作效率
五、总结与展望 综上所述,Xshell在提示用户下载并使用Xftp进行文件传输时,不仅是对用户需求的精准把握,更是对Xftp专业能力的充分认可
Xftp以其高效的传输效率、强大的稳定性、丰富的功能以及安全的数据传输特性,成为了众多开发者和运维人员在文件传输领域的首选工具
未来,随着云计算、大数据等技术的不断发展,文件传输的需求将会更加多样化和复杂化
相信Xftp将继续发挥其专业优势,为用户提供更加高效、便捷、安全的文件传输服务
同时,我们也期待Xshell与Xftp能够进一步深度融合和优化,为用户带来更加流畅和愉悦的远程服务器管理和文件传输体验